GATE COAP 2025 Round 1 Opens Today: Seat Offers Begin Rolling In

GATE COAP 2025 Round 1 begins today, allowing candidates to access M.Tech seat offers from IITs and IISc. Options like Accept & Freeze, Retain & Wait, and Reject & Wait are now live. Timely decision-making is key for securing top choices. Candidates must act quickly as each round has strict timelines.

NLP Concept Illustration

The highly anticipated GATE COAP 2025 Round 1 has officially started today, marking a crucial phase for engineering graduates aspiring for M.Tech admissions in top Indian institutes. The Common Offer Acceptance Portal (COAP) facilitates a unified platform through which candidates can view and respond to admission offers made by various participating IITs and IISc Bangalore.

The portal simplifies the selection process, offering candidates a transparent and time-bound mechanism to accept or hold their seat offers. It's essential for all registered candidates to understand the decision-making options to maximize their chances.


How the COAP 2025 Seat Allotment Process Works

Candidates receive offers from participating institutes based on their GATE scores.

Each offer round allows candidates to choose from three options:

Accept & Freeze

Retain & Wait

Reject & Wait

Offers are made only through COAP and cannot be accessed on individual institute portals.


Important Instructions for Candidates

Log in to the COAP portal using your credentials to view Round 1 offers.

Select your preferred option before the deadline to ensure your seat isn’t forfeited.

Missing deadlines or indecisiveness may reduce your chances in subsequent rounds.

Candidates can participate in further rounds if they choose to “Retain & Wait.”


Participating Institutes and GATE Score Criteria

All major IITs, including Bombay, Delhi, Kanpur, Madras, and Kharagpur, are part of COAP.

GATE scores from 2023, 2024, or 2025 are valid for participation.

Offers are based on academic eligibility, GATE performance, and institute-specific criteria.
